An Exceptional Lifestyle Estate Offering Luxury Living, Expansive Land,
Trails, and Ponds
Set atop one of the highest hills in the area, this commanding estate
offers sweeping, long-range views and a powerful sense of presence while
still maintaining privacy at the end of a 1,200-foot driveway. The driveway is lined with beautiful flowering trees
and rises beneath a canopy of green leaves, creating a striking approach
that opens to rolling farmland, wooded forest, and open green pasture.
From the residence, expansive deck areas on all three levels—each
accessed by double doors—invite seamless indoor-outdoor living and
frame panoramic vistas stretching for miles, delivering grand sunsets
and an ever-changing countryside backdrop. Wildlife is abundant
throughout the property, enhancing the connection to the land.
Built in 2011, the 7,500-square-foot custom home is architecturally
striking, featuring multiple roof contours that add depth and character
to the exterior. A dramatic dry-stack stone chimney rises three full
stories from the basement-level exterior near the pool to the roofline,
serving as a commanding focal point and a testament to the home’s
craftsmanship. Inside, the foyer and main living room are defined by
soaring twenty-foot ceilings, creating an immediate sense of scale,
light, and architectural presence. An angled solid oak staircase with
custom railing ascends gracefully through the space, leading to a
distinctive bridge-style upper level that connects the primary suite to
the additional bedrooms while overlooking the living areas below.
Throughout the home, solid oak trim and doors reflect a commitment to
quality materials and timeless design.
The residence offers four bedrooms and four bathrooms. An open kitchen flows seamlessly into the living area,
ideal for both everyday living and entertaining. A large formal dining
room, private study, and three fireplaces add warmth and distinction
throughout the home. The upstairs primary bedroom features a gas
fireplace, creating a cozy and inviting private retreat, while the two
additional fireplaces are wood fired, offering traditional
ambiance and timeless character. The primary suite is further enhanced
by a jacuzzi tub, walk-in closet, private balcony.
The finished basement expands the home’s living and
entertaining space with a secondary kitchen, full bathroom,
recreation area and exercise equipment.
Double doors lead directly from the basement to a cobblestone
concrete patio just steps from the in-ground pool, creating effortless
flow between indoor and outdoor entertaining.
Outdoor living and recreation extend across the land itself. In addition
to ponds ideal for fishing from a kayak or off the dock. The property offers
exceptional hunting opportunities, including strong deer populations,
abundant turkey hunting, and small game such as squirrel.
Nearly two miles of private trails wind through ridge-top fields
and forest, ideal for hiking.
